LONG BEACH - The City Council unanimously approved new fire safety rules on Tuesday for high-rise and multi-unit apartment buildings.
Long Beach Fire Department officials described how this new rule, which also applies to hotels and motels with 50 or more units under one roof, requires owners of such buildings to install fire sprinklers or take alternative measures.See the full content of this document
